Abstract

A molded product having a phase separation structure formed by photopolymerization of a photopolymerizable composition and imparting a sharp diffraction spot at a high diffraction efficiency, and a method for manufacturing same are provided. The molded product ( 1 ) comprises a matrix ( 2 ) and a multiple columnar structures ( 3 ) disposed within the matrix ( 2 ) and having an index of refraction different from the matrix ( 2 ), wherein the half width of a diffraction spot is 0.6° or less and diffraction efficiency is 10% or greater in an angular spectrum obtained by irradiation with a laser beam having an intensity distribution of standard normal distribution and a half width of the intensity distribution of 0.5°. The multiple columnar structures ( 3 ) are oriented in approximately the same direction, and are aligned in a regular lattice on a plane perpendicular to said orientation direction.

Claims (7)

1. A method for manufacturing a molded product having a phase structure, comprising a matrix formed of a photopolymerizable composition, and multiple columnar structures disposed within said matrix and having an index of refraction different from said matrix, comprising:

a step for injecting the photopolymerizable composition containing a photopolymerizable monomer or oligomer and a photoinitiator into a mold;

a step for disposing a photomask having light-transmissive regions and a light non-transmissive region between the mold and a light source;

a first light irradiation step for irradiating parallel light from the light source with a wavelength full width at half maximum of 100 nm or less and an essentially uniform light intensity distribution through the photomask toward the photopolymerizable composition within the mold to polymerize those sites within the photopolymerizable composition which are irradiated with parallel light into an incompletely polymerized state; and

a second light irradiation step for irradiating parallel light with a wavelength full width at half maximum of 100 nm or less and an essentially uniform light intensity distribution toward the photopolymerizable composition within the mold after removing the photomask to complete the polymerization of the photopolymerizable composition,

wherein in the photomask, many of the light-transmissive regions are disposed in a regular lattice in the light non-transmissive region.

2. A method for manufacturing the molded product in claim 1 , whereby in the first light irradiation step, the photopolymerizable composition is polymerized to a polymerization degree of 10% or greater and 80% or less.
